Tip #6: mind your shutter speeds. bears can move surprisingly quick, and slow shutter speeds simply don’t work well for action shots. i recommend a minimum shutter speed of 1 500sec for general use and anywhere from 1 800s to 1 1250s for fast action. this is especially true if snowflakes or water droplets are being flung into the air.
